Central Park Hotel No Longer Under Mövenpick Management

The Central Park Hotel in Rome is no longer part of the Mövenpick Hotels & Resorts’ portfolio. The management contract between the owner company I.R.P.S. (Immobiliare Residenziale Pineta Sacchetti s.r.l.) and the international hotel chain based in Switzerland was terminated by mutual agreement on 1 April 2008.

The 4-star hotel with 162 rooms and suites, restaurants and banqueting facilities was part of Mövenpick Hotels & Resorts since November 2001 and was the Swiss Hotel Group’s only operation in Italy.

“We can look back on a pleasant association with I.R.P.S.”, says Jean Gabriel Pérès, President & CEO of Mövenpick Hotels & Resorts. “We regret that strategic reasons have now brought the partnership to an end. Rome and Italy, however, are still part of our development plans.”
